怎么解除excel加密文档密码

怎么解除excel加密文档密码

解除Excel加密文档密码的方法包括:使用已知密码解锁、使用密码恢复工具、使用VBA代码、通过第三方服务解锁。 接下来将详细介绍使用已知密码解锁的方法。

要解除Excel文档的密码保护,最简单的方法是使用已知密码解锁。打开文件后,进入“文件”菜单,选择“信息”,然后点击“保护工作簿”,选择“用密码进行加密”,在弹出的对话框中删除密码,最后保存文件即可。这种方法只适用于你已经知道密码的情况。

一、使用已知密码解锁

当你已经知道Excel文件的密码时,解除密码保护相对简单。以下是详细步骤:

  1. 打开文件:首先,用已知密码打开Excel文件。
  2. 进入文件菜单:点击左上角的“文件”选项。
  3. 选择信息:在文件菜单中选择“信息”。
  4. 保护工作簿:点击“保护工作簿”按钮。
  5. 用密码进行加密:选择“用密码进行加密”选项。
  6. 删除密码:在弹出的对话框中删除已有的密码,然后点击“确定”。
  7. 保存文件:最后,保存文件,这样Excel文件就不再有密码保护了。

这个方法非常直观,适用于你有密码并能够正常打开文件的情况。接下来,我们讨论其他几种在你不知道密码时的解决方案。

二、使用密码恢复工具

如果你忘记了Excel文件的密码,可以考虑使用密码恢复工具。这些工具利用计算机算法尝试破解密码。下面介绍几款常见的密码恢复工具及其使用方法。

1. PassFab for Excel

PassFab for Excel 是一款专门用于恢复Excel密码的软件,支持多种Excel版本。其主要特点是操作简单,恢复速度快。以下是使用步骤:

  1. 下载并安装软件:首先从官方网站下载并安装PassFab for Excel。
  2. 加载文件:启动软件后,点击“添加”按钮加载需要解锁的Excel文件。
  3. 选择攻击模式:软件提供三种攻击模式:字典攻击、暴力攻击和掩码攻击。根据你的情况选择合适的模式。
  4. 开始恢复:点击“开始”按钮,软件会自动进行密码恢复。恢复完成后,会显示密码。

2. Stellar Phoenix Excel Password Recovery

Stellar Phoenix Excel Password Recovery 也是一款高效的密码恢复工具,支持所有版本的Excel文件。以下是使用步骤:

  1. 下载并安装软件:从官方网站下载并安装Stellar Phoenix Excel Password Recovery。
  2. 选择文件:启动软件后,点击“选择文件”按钮加载Excel文件。
  3. 选择恢复选项:软件提供三种恢复选项:暴力攻击、掩码攻击和字典攻击。根据你的情况选择合适的选项。
  4. 开始恢复:点击“开始”按钮,软件会开始恢复密码。恢复完成后,会显示密码。

三、使用VBA代码

如果你对编程有一定了解,可以尝试使用VBA代码来解除Excel密码。VBA(Visual Basic for Applications)是Excel的编程语言,可以用来编写宏来破解密码。

1. 使用简单的VBA代码

以下是一个简单的VBA代码示例,可以用来解除Excel工作表的保护密码:

Sub PasswordBreaker()

Dim i As Integer, j As Integer, k As Integer

Dim l As Integer, m As Integer, n As Integer

On Error Resume Next

For i = 65 To 66: For j = 65 To 66: For k = 65 To 66

For l = 65 To 66: For m = 65 To 66: For n = 65 To 66

ActiveSheet.Unprotect Chr(i) & Chr(j) & Chr(k) & Chr(l) & Chr(m) & Chr(n)

If ActiveSheet.ProtectContents = False Then

MsgBox "Password is " & Chr(i) & Chr(j) & Chr(k) & Chr(l) & Chr(m) & Chr(n)

Exit Sub

End If

Next: Next: Next: Next: Next: Next

End Sub

使用步骤:

  1. 打开Excel文件:用已知密码打开Excel文件。
  2. 进入VBA编辑器:按 Alt + F11 进入VBA编辑器。
  3. 插入模块:在VBA编辑器中,点击“插入”->“模块”,然后粘贴上面的代码。
  4. 运行代码:按 F5 运行代码,代码会尝试解除工作表保护,并显示密码。

2. 使用高级VBA代码

对于保护较为复杂的Excel文件,可以使用更高级的VBA代码。以下是一个更复杂的VBA代码示例:

Sub PasswordBreaker()

Dim i As Integer, j As Integer, k As Integer

Dim l As Integer, m As Integer, n As Integer

Dim a As String

On Error Resume Next

For i = 65 To 90: For j = 65 To 90: For k = 65 To 90

For l = 65 To 90: For m = 65 To 90: For n = 65 To 90

a = Chr(i) & Chr(j) & Chr(k) & Chr(l) & Chr(m) & Chr(n)

ActiveSheet.Unprotect a

If ActiveSheet.ProtectContents = False Then

MsgBox "Password is " & a

Exit Sub

End If

Next: Next: Next: Next: Next: Next

End Sub

使用步骤与上面的简单VBA代码相同。运行后,代码会尝试解除工作表保护,并显示密码。

四、通过第三方服务解锁

如果你不希望自己动手,也可以考虑使用第三方服务来解锁Excel文件。这些服务通常是付费的,但可以节省时间和精力。

1. Password-Find.com

Password-Find.com 是一个在线解锁服务,支持多种文件格式,包括Excel。以下是使用步骤:

  1. 访问网站:打开Password-Find.com网站。
  2. 上传文件:点击“选择文件”按钮,上传需要解锁的Excel文件。
  3. 支付费用:根据文件的复杂程度,支付相应的费用。
  4. 下载解锁文件:支付完成后,网站会提供解锁后的文件下载链接。

2. LostMyPass.com

LostMyPass.com 也是一个在线解锁服务,支持多种文件格式。以下是使用步骤:

  1. 访问网站:打开LostMyPass.com网站。
  2. 上传文件:点击“选择文件”按钮,上传需要解锁的Excel文件。
  3. 支付费用:根据文件的复杂程度,支付相应的费用。
  4. 下载解锁文件:支付完成后,网站会提供解锁后的文件下载链接。

总结

解除Excel加密文档密码的方法有很多,选择哪种方法取决于你的具体情况。如果你已经知道密码,可以直接在Excel中解除。如果你忘记了密码,可以使用密码恢复工具、VBA代码或第三方服务。每种方法都有其优缺点和适用场景,希望本文能帮助你找到最适合的方法来解除Excel密码。

相关问答FAQs:

1. 如何解除Excel加密文档的密码?

  • 问题: 我忘记了Excel加密文档的密码,该怎么解除密码保护?
  • 回答: 如果你忘记了Excel加密文档的密码,可以尝试以下方法解除密码保护:
    • 使用密码恢复软件:有一些专门用于恢复Excel密码的软件,可以通过暴力破解或字典攻击的方式来解除密码保护。
    • 使用VBA宏代码:在Excel中按下Alt + F11打开VBA编辑器,然后插入以下代码:
      Sub PasswordBreaker()
          On Error Resume Next
          For i = 65 To 66: For j = 65 To 66: For k = 65 To 66
          For l = 65 To 66: For m = 65 To 66: For i1 = 65 To 66
          For i2 = 65 To 66: For i3 = 65 To 66: For i4 = 65 To 66
          For i5 = 65 To 66: For i6 = 65 To 66: For n = 32 To 126
          ActiveSheet.Unprotect Chr(i) & Chr(j) & Chr(k) & _
          Chr(l) & Chr(m) & Chr(i1) & Chr(i2) & Chr(i3) & _
          Chr(i4) & Chr(i5) & Chr(i6) & Chr(n)
          If ActiveSheet.ProtectContents = False Then
              MsgBox "密码已被破解:" & Chr(i) & Chr(j) & _
              Chr(k) & Chr(l) & Chr(m) & Chr(i1) & Chr(i2) & _
              Chr(i3) & Chr(i4) & Chr(i5) & Chr(i6) & Chr(n)
              Exit Sub
          End If
          Next: Next: Next: Next: Next: Next
          Next: Next: Next: Next: Next: Next
      End Sub
      

      然后按下F5运行代码,如果密码被破解,会弹出一个消息框显示密码。

    • 使用在线解密工具:有一些在线工具可以帮助你解密Excel加密文档的密码,你可以在搜索引擎中搜索相关工具并按照工具提供的步骤操作。

2. 如何修改Excel加密文档的密码?

  • 问题: 我想修改Excel加密文档的密码,应该如何操作?
  • 回答: 如果你想修改Excel加密文档的密码,可以按照以下步骤进行操作:
    1. 打开Excel加密文档,点击“文件”选项卡。
    2. 在文件选项卡下拉菜单中,选择“信息”。
    3. 在信息面板的右侧,找到“保护工作簿”部分,点击“加密密码”旁边的“更改密码”按钮。
    4. 在弹出的“更改密码”对话框中,输入当前密码和新密码,然后点击“确定”按钮。
    5. 如果你想删除密码保护,可以在“更改密码”对话框中将新密码留空,然后点击“确定”按钮。
    6. 保存Excel文档,新密码将会生效。

3. Excel加密文档的密码可以被破解吗?

  • 问题: Excel加密文档的密码可以被破解吗?我应该如何保护我的文档?
  • 回答: Excel加密文档的密码理论上是可以被破解的,但破解密码需要一定的时间和计算资源。为了保护你的文档,你可以采取以下措施:
    • 使用强密码:使用至少8个字符的密码,并包含大小写字母、数字和特殊字符,以增加破解的难度。
    • 使用文件级别的加密:在保存Excel文档时,选择使用“高级加密标准”(AES)进行加密,这种加密方式更安全。
    • 定期更改密码:定期更改Excel加密文档的密码可以增加保护的安全性。
    • 限制访问权限:如果只有少数人需要访问Excel文档,可以设置访问权限,只允许授权人员访问。
    • 备份重要文档:定期备份Excel文档,并将备份文件存储在安全的位置,以防止数据丢失或被损坏。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4861903

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部